14 year old Jaz has been sent to live with her crazy Aunt Agnes in Wakkaville, an out of the way smudge on the map full of crazy kids
and psychotic adults. Wakkaville is as different from Sydney as night from day, but she’s stuck here now and has to make the most of it. Can a big city girl survive small town life? Only time (and Flick, Martin & Buzza, her unexpected friends) will tell...
JAZ – City slick, smart and brave. She’s a bluetooth-using, bandwidth abusing, tech smart blogger from Sydney.
She finds herself exiled to Wakkaville, a place so old fashioned that kids are meant to be seen and not heard. Which is a problem; ‘cos she’s got stuff to say, and everyone needs to hear it!
Together with Flick, her pain in the butt tag along (and self appointed) tour guide, Martin, her quiet but surprisingly prankish Cowboy neighbour and Buzza, the local surfer wannabe (totally aqua-phobic), Jaz makes it her mission to drag the town of Wakkaville kicking and screaming into the 21st century!
